Nodejs移植到嵌入式ARM板有3種方法:
1. 交叉編譯可執(zhí)行文件
在上位機(jī)虛擬機(jī)軟件上安裝ARM的交叉編譯鏈,下載nodejs源碼,使用交叉編譯軟件編譯nodejs,得到ARM板上可執(zhí)行的文件,并放到ARM板上,通過(guò)node xxx.js文件的方式執(zhí)行。注意還需要移植依賴(lài)庫(kù)到ARM板上。該方式適合小型的nodejs程序,例如一個(gè)小型web服務(wù)。
2. PKG打包法
需要一臺(tái)與ARM相同架構(gòu)并自帶ubuntu或統(tǒng)信等系統(tǒng)的設(shè)備,在上面安裝部署nodejs的環(huán)境,使用run pkg打包的方法在該環(huán)境下將源碼打包成應(yīng)用程序的可執(zhí)行文件,然后將應(yīng)用程序的可執(zhí)行文件拷貝到ARM開(kāi)發(fā)板上文章來(lái)源:http://www.zghlxwxcb.cn/news/detail-759372.html
3. ARM板直接安裝法
該方法需要ARM的操作系統(tǒng)功能比較完善,而不是閹割版系統(tǒng)。在該系統(tǒng)下直接安裝nodejs的環(huán)境,并運(yùn)行程序。文章來(lái)源地址http://www.zghlxwxcb.cn/news/detail-759372.html
到了這里,關(guān)于Nodejs移植到嵌入式ARM板方法的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!